hello mam /sir I'm mother of 5yrs old daughter. Now I'm 33 we are plan for next baby in recent 3 to 4 months but it doesn't work wht will we do pls help us .

A. Trying to conceive can be a complex process, and several factors can influence your success. Here are steps you can take to improve your chances of getting pregnant and address potential concerns:
### Steps to Take
1. **Track Your Cycle**:
- **Ovulation Tracking**: Use ovulation predictor kits or track basal body temperature to identify your fertile window. Timing intercourse around ovulation can increase your chances of conception.
2. **Healthy Lifestyle**:
- **Nutrition**: Maintain a bal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, lean proteins, and healthy fats. Consider taking prenatal vitamins with folic acid.
- **Exercise**: Regular physical activity can help maintain a healthy weight and support overall fertility.
- **Avoid Toxins**: Limit alcohol, caffeine, and avoid smoking or exposure to environmental toxins.
3. **Medical Evaluation**:
- **Consult Your Doctor**: Schedule a preconception check-up with your healthcare provider. They can assess your overall health and address any concerns related to fertility.
- **Assess Health Conditions**: Ensure that any existing health conditions, such as PCOS or thyroid issues, are managed effectively.
4. **Fertility Testing**:
- **Assess Fertility**: If you have been trying to conceive for a year or more without success (or six months if you're over 35), consider seeing a fertility specialist for evaluation. They can perform tests to assess both partners' reproductive health.
5. **Stress Management**:
- **Reduce Stress**: High stress levels can impact fertility. Consider stress-relief techniques such as yoga, meditation, or counseling.
6. **Partner Health**:
- **Male Fertility**: Ensure that your partner is also in good health and consider having him evaluated for any potential fertility issues.
### When to Seek Professional Help
- **Duration**: If you’ve been actively trying for more than a year (or six months if you’re over 35) without success, or if you have irregular cycles or other reproductive health concerns, it’s time to consult a fertility specialist.
### Conclusion
Improving fertility involves a combination of tracking ovulation, maintaining a healthy lifestyle, and addressing any medical concerns. If you have been trying to conceive without success for several months, consider seeking advice from a healthcare provider or fertility specialist for personalized guidance and testing.
